At Heart of Kent Hospice we have a reputation for delivering first-class training to other health and social care professionals, including the NHS, care homes, the voluntary sector and local authorities.

Heart of Kent Hospice colleagues

Our mission is to improve end-of-life care for our community.

We are committed to sharing best practice to help raise standards of end-of-life care, so that every person with a terminal illness in our catchment area has the support they and their family needs, whether they are a patient of ours or under someone else’s care. We offer a variety of courses that are held face to face and virtually. 

All of our courses are planned and facilitated by our team of clinical or community specialists and include a range of learning approaches including theory, discussion, reflection and participation.
